How do you craft a high dps weapon?

So I am fairly new to the crafting system. My basic understanding would be, and please correct me if I`m wrong:


I get a high level item like Vaal axe with ilevel 79. I roll so long alterations on it until I have either high IAS and throw another augment on it for high phys % dps to get like cruel/tyrannical (http://www.poemods.com/index.php?item_type=2h_sword_axe) or vise versa with the alts/augmentations, then regal it and voila that's it?

I wonder if I miss something spent today about 50chaos in alterations and still nothing -_-
does it have to be 20% before trying to get a good roll?

thanks

Could you please explain in detail, do you mean rather than hoping for cruel/tyrannical I should rather look for tempered/flaring and then regal?
My bad, I did not write correctly. You should look for either one, they have, according to the datamined chances, the same chance to roll. Then you should regal into a flat physical roll. Or do the flag physical first.

If you manage to get both after regaling you are set. But keep in mind that hitting a t2 or t1 mode will cost several hundred alt.

Crafting will cost around 5 to 10 times more than buying the same item.
